Women Walking West (W3) depends heavily on the work and commitment of its volunteer mentors who are selected based on their level of education and their academic or industrial experience. The approval process to accept a volunteer mentor is comprehensive in order to make sure they are competent in their field of expertise and also possess a high level of integrity that matches the values established by W3. When women contact W3, they are assigned to a Mentor that will monitor and assist in their progress until each woman’s goal is met. Below are examples of services provided by Women Walking West: 

Viktoria Tara from the country of Kazakhstan received scholarship from Women Walking West 

Viktoria Tara from the country of Kazakhstan received scholarship from Women Walking West to continue her education at Central Ohio Technical Colleges majoring in Diagnostic Medical Sonography. The scholarship was awarded by to Tara by Dr. George Sehi Women Walking West Board Chair and Dr. Bonnie Coe, President of Central Ohio Technical College. 

Samantha Low Receives Scholarship 

Dr. George Sehi, Women Walking West Board Chair, and Dr. Bonnie Coe, President of Central Ohio Technical College, presented a Certificate of Achievement to Samantha Low for receiving a scholarship from Women Walking West. Samantha is studying Cardiovascular Sonography at Central Ohio Technical College.

$1000 scholarship to Jung Breitfelder 

Sinclair Community College student from South Korea was awarded scholarship through Women Walking West. Dr. George Sehi, Women Walking West Board Chair and Dr. DeAnn Hurtado, Associate Dean of Sinclair Community College Courseview campus, presented a $1000 scholarship to Jung Breitfelder, who is pursuing an associate degree in Business.

Chinese Student Receives Scholarship 

On Tuesday, November 17, 2015 Women Walking West awarded Lin Xu its first scholarship. Ms. Lin Xu will be attending Central Ohio Technical College in the spring term of 2016, majoring in sonography.
